Look on the build sticker in the boot and see if either of those PR codes appears.

  • Author
3 hours ago, Wino said:

Look on the build sticker in the boot and see if either of those PR codes appears.

Where about is this sticker? Never noticed it?

  • Sponsor

Usually under any carpet near the spare wheel well. May be a copy of it in the service book too.
